 A Traitor, You


A traitor, you're found guilty of

Entering, then breaking my heart,

In cruel betrayal of my love,

Ripping my happiness apart.

A traitor, you ran away from

The good love nest I thought we built.

You must have thought I am too dumb

To ever find you full of guilt.

A traitor, you now dare to bring

More pain and grief to me to bear,

By flaunting off your latest fling,

Making me one you must beware.


A traitor, you're found guilty sure.

Now I'm you're executioner.
